Pegatron, an iPhone assembly and production company, recorded record sales in 2019, up 2% year-on-year. In the background is the strong sales of iPhone11.

Strong iPhone 11 rises

Pegatron reported revenue for December 2019 decreased by 9.5% month-on-month and by 21.8% year-on-year in December 2019, reaching TWD1,366.2 billion for the full year of 2019 (approximately ¥ 5,166.0 billion) Revealed that. This has surpassed TWD 1 trillion for the sixth consecutive year, setting a new record for sales for the second consecutive year.

If you look at the year-on-year growth rate, you can see how the iPhone 11 has significantly contributed to Pegatron sales.

Pegatron Chairman Doji said that although the fourth quarter (October-December) is the end of the busy season and is in the “hibernation period,” in 2019, various factories in Japan and abroad will be affected by US-China trade friction. He explained that the operation was successful, and as a result, it was performing well.

Also, if it is as usual, the first quarter of 2020 (January to March) will enter a quiet period, but this year Apple will not only be in the second half but also in the first half (March 2020) of the new iPhone (iPhone SE 2 , IPhone9) are also rumored to be announced.

What happens to iPhone SE 2?

It is unknown at this time which company will undertake the assembly of the iPhone SE 2, but if Pegatron, who has been in charge of the low-priced version of the iPhone lineup, will be in charge, the company is likely to gain further profits.

By the way, iPhone SE 2 has already released a rendering that is based on the leaked CAD image, and it is expected that it will be a single camera of iPhone 8 size. Biometric authentication is expected to be equipped with Touch ID, and if released, it will definitely be a fairly cheap model.
